AGS (Engg.) Com J. Saibaba and Com Amit Kumar Gupta, AGS AIRBSNLEWA met Shri
Pracheesh Khanna, Director (Estt) DoT and discussed regarding reply to DoE on
78.2% IDA pay fixation of BSNL pensioners. Director (Estt)
informed that reply from DoT to DoE has been sent on 11th July, 2014;
on the issue of 60%:40% he mentioned that as per DoT internal finance
clarification the pension paid by the Govt. from 01.10.2000 to 31.03.2010 was
less than the 60% of the revenue receipt under specified heads from BSNL but
the same was reversed from the year 2011-12 on wards due to reduction in
revenue receipt and increase in pension liability. He further mentioned that
presently the receipt from BSNL to DoT are about Rs. 6000 Crores per annum and
the pension being paid is also about Rs 6000 Crores only. Hence, the Rs 2400 Crores
are being paid more by DoT on pension payment as per 60% : 40% formula. However,
the reply has been sent to DoE to allow to calculate the pensionary benefits of
employees retired between 01.01.2007 to 09.06.2013 on notional basis pay
fixation and to take cabinet approval for revision of pensionary benefits of
pre-2007 retires, Director (Estt.) assured to pursue the matter in DoE after a
week’s time for an early approval.
